Meet The Darlins–Country Music’s Newest Duo

The Darlins

The Darlins, a Franklin duo who has everyone talking, has just released an EP titled Crush. The duo–Erinn Bates and Jude Toy–first met in Sephora and their friendship developed into a musical collaboration. Erinn was born and raised in Music City and Jude is from Oregon, but she likes Franklin so much, she has decided to call Franklin home.

How did The Darlins come about?

Erinn: I saw Jude play at the Bluebird Cafe and I thought she was amazing. But actually we met at Sephora in Green Hills believe it or not. We were both solo artists but we had heard about each other and how talented each other was. From there, we just  decided to start working together.

Why the name The Darlins? 

Jude: My parents were huge Andy Griffin Show fans. In that show, there is the family the Darlins so I thought that would be a great name for a band and luckily Erinn agreed.
